At last year's San Diego comic-con, convention-goers heeding the call of nature were greeted by large prohibitive signs outside the restrooms. Facilities, they stated, were strictly off-limits to non-human life forms. Rather than a cruel joke at the expense of the average Con patron, the signage was the beginning of a teaser campaign for District 9, a Peter Jackson-produced sci-fi outing written and directed by erstwhile Halo helmer, Neill Blomkamp.
The Background:
The origins of District 9 can be traced to Blomkamp's 2005 short film Alive In Joburg (look it up on YouTube), a low-budget mockumentary about the life of non-humans since the first ship appeared. Given the tone of its publicity campaign, it seems likely that D9 will take a similar documentary style as it follows the plight of the oppressed E.T.s.
The Aliens:
The tendril-faced aliens themselves are given no title beyond the PC sobriquet "non-humans", and live in squalid conditions. Employed to perform menial tasks, they are required to have their occupation stamped on their head and are abused by sadistic MNU soldiers. An underground militant group called Pro Forma are attempting to redress this situation - by any means necessary.
